Travis from Backyard Berry on Substack shares about his series "Building a Sustainable Nursery".

His favorite trees: Pawpaws, Persimmons, and Pin Cherries (for the birds).

We also talk about his series on "Homegrown National Park". Everyone was talking about national parks being affected by Federal land sales a few weeks ago. Travis posted that "What if the largest national park in America wasn’t a remote wilderness, but your own backyard?"

The idea: "transforming America’s private land into vibrant habitat corridors that restore biodiversity and ecological health."

Travis also shares about what it is like to work on an organic vegetable farm.
